What Is a Gallinipper Mosquito?

The term Gallinipper typically refers to certain very large mosquitoes belonging to the genus Psorophora, particularly Psorophora ciliata. These mosquitoes are colloquially known as “gallinippers” mainly in the southeastern United States. The name “gallinipper” is believed to have originated from African American folklore and Southern vernacular, describing a particularly large, aggressive mosquito.

Physical Characteristics

Gallinippers are renowned for their remarkable size compared to common mosquitoes:

  • Body Size: Adult Gallinippers can reach up to 2–3 centimeters (0.8–1.2 inches) in length, making them some of the largest mosquitoes in North America.
  • Wingspan: Their wingspan can be around 2.5 centimeters.
  • Coloration: They typically have dark bodies with distinctive white or pale markings on their legs and body segments.
  • Appearance: Their hairy legs and robust bodies give them a somewhat scary appearance that has contributed to their legendary status.

Behavior and Feeding Habits

Gallinippers differ from many other mosquito species in several behavioral traits:

  • Aggressiveness: They are known to be very aggressive biters. Unlike some mosquitoes that mainly feed at dawn or dusk, gallinippers may be active during the day.
  • Feeding Preference: Females feed on blood to obtain proteins necessary for egg development. Males primarily feed on nectar and plant juices.
  • Bite Impact: Their bites can be quite painful compared to smaller mosquito species due to their larger mouthparts and saliva composition.

Life Cycle

Like other mosquitoes, gallinippers undergo a complete metamorphosis with four life stages:

  1. Egg: Females lay eggs on moist soil or temporary pools of water created by rainfall.
  2. Larva: Eggs hatch into larvae that live in water for several days or weeks, feeding on organic material and microorganisms.
  3. Pupa: Following larval stages, they transform into pupae, which are also aquatic but non-feeding.
  4. Adult: After pupation, adults emerge from the water surface ready to mate and continue the cycle.

One unique factor about gallinippers is that their eggs can remain dormant for years if dry conditions persist, hatching only when flooded by rainwater. This adaptation allows them to survive in areas with intermittent water availability.

Where Does the Gallinipper Mosquito Live?

Gallinipper mosquitoes tend to inhabit specific environments where their life cycle requirements are met. Understanding their habitat helps explain their distribution patterns.

Geographic Distribution

Gallinippers are primarily found in:

  • Southeastern United States: States like Florida, Georgia, Alabama, Louisiana, Mississippi, South Carolina, and Texas report frequent gallinipper presence.
  • Caribbean Islands: Some species or close relatives exist in Caribbean tropical environments.
  • Central America: Parts of Central America have similar species with comparable behavior.

These regions share warm climates with seasonal rains that create ideal breeding grounds for gallinippers.

Preferred Habitats

Gallinippers favor habitats that provide abundant temporary pools or flooded areas for egg-laying:

  • Flooded Fields and Pastures: After heavy rains or flooding events, grassy fields become breeding hotspots.
  • Swamps and Marshes: Wetlands with standing water offer excellent environments for larvae.
  • Ditches and Temporary Pools: Water collected in roadside ditches or depressions serves as ideal breeding sites.
  • Wooded Areas with Adequate Moisture: Forested wetlands may also harbor gallinipper populations.

Unlike some urban-adapted mosquitoes that breed in containers or artificial sites, gallinippers generally prefer natural or semi-natural environments with ephemeral water bodies.

Environmental Conditions

Several environmental factors influence gallinipper populations:

  • Rainfall Patterns: Since egg hatching depends heavily on flooding events, rainy seasons trigger population surges.
  • Temperature: Warm temperatures accelerate larval development and increase adult activity.
  • Vegetation Cover: Dense vegetation offers shelter from wind and predators while providing resting sites for adults.

Why Do Gallinipper Mosquitoes Matter?

Beyond their impressive size and painful bite, gallinippers have ecological and practical importance worth noting.

Ecological Role

Gallinipper mosquitoes play several roles within ecosystems:

  • Food Source: Larvae provide food for aquatic predators like fish and amphibians; adults serve as prey for birds, bats, dragonflies, and spiders.
  • Pollination: Male mosquitoes contribute to pollination by feeding on flower nectar.
  • Population Control Dynamics: As aggressive blood feeders, they influence host animal behavior and population health indirectly.

Human Impact

Gallinippers are often regarded as pests due to:

  • Painful Bites: Their bite is not just itchy but painful enough to cause discomfort lasting several days.
  • Aggressiveness: Unlike more timid species, gallinippers actively chase humans making outdoor activities challenging during peak seasons.

However, it’s important to note that unlike some mosquito species such as Aedes aegypti or Anopheles spp., gallinippers are not known major vectors of human diseases like malaria or Zika virus.

Challenges in Control

Controlling gallinipper populations poses challenges because:

  • Their eggs can remain dormant for extended periods waiting for flood conditions.
  • Their preference for natural wetlands limits the effectiveness of insecticide spraying without harming beneficial wildlife.

Integrated pest management strategies focusing on habitat modification (e.g., drainage improvement) alongside public education offer promising approaches.

How To Protect Yourself From Gallinipper Mosquitoes

If you live in or visit gallinipper-prone areas during wet seasons:

  1. Use Insect Repellents containing DEET or picaridin on exposed skin.
  2. Wear Protective Clothing such as long sleeves and pants when outdoors at dawn or dusk.
  3. Avoid Peak Activity Times especially after rain events when adults emerge in large numbers.
  4. Eliminate Standing Water near homes when possible to reduce breeding sites.
  5. Consider using physical barriers like window screens and bed nets if staying overnight in endemic zones.
